I purchased a Canon PIXMA MG2922 printer as a backup.  Never been opened. Never been taken out of the Canon PIXMA MG2922 box.  Never been used.  Just sat up in a closet.

 

One of my trusted printers failed to operate so I decided to open my Canon PIXMA MG2922 backup.

 

The printer will not initialize.

 

Everything is checked out paper, ink cartridges, door closed, unpacked properly, and made sure all of the packing tape and plastic pieces were removed.

 

When I plug the printer power cord into the wall outlet (various outlets),  the only thing that happens is the Alarm light is solid orange.  That's it.  The printer should be making noise (loud) according to videos.

 

When you push the power button, the power light is solid green and the alarm light is solid orange.

 

I have tried numerous methods of resetting this printer and everyone has failed.

Paper Jam

  • Check for Jammed Paper: Open the printer cover and inspect for any paper that may be stuck inside. Remove any jammed paper carefully to avoid damaging the printer.
  • Reload Paper: Ensure that the paper tray is loaded correctly with properly aligned sheets.

Ink Cartridge Issues

  • Check Cartridge Installation: Make sure the ink cartridges are installed correctly. Remove and reinstall them to ensure they are seated properly.
  • Check Ink Levels: If the cartridges are low on ink, replace them with new ones.

Troubleshooting Steps

  1. Inspect for Paper Jams: Open the printer and look for any stuck paper.
  2. Reinstall Ink Cartridges: Remove the cartridges and reinstall them securely.
  3. Reset the Printer: Turn off the printer, hold the Stop button, then press and hold the Power button. Release both buttons when the green light is steady, then press Stop four times.

If these steps do not resolve the issue, consider reaching out to Canon Support for further assistance.
